Principles and concepts of multistatic surveillance radars
Abstract
Various aspects of high-data-rate multibeam multistatic surveillance radars are reported. Problems encountered in monostatic radar performance are identified as clutter and various types of interference. Multistatic radar systems are described in terms of the separation of transmitting and receiving sites, Doppler processing procedures, transmitter modulations, locating sources of repetitive interfering pulses, and passive detection techniques. Consideration is given to various system components such as the transmitting array, sequential scan, floodlight, and multibeam configurations. System performance is outlined with reference to target detection against receiver noise and the detection of interference sources.
